## Alert: Session-Token Refresh Failure (Lanternly Auth)

This alert fires when more than 2% of refresh attempts on the Lanternly auth service return stale tokens within a five-minute window. Users may be silently logged out mid-session. Check the token-rotation job first; a stuck rotation is the usual culprit. If you cannot resolve it within fifteen minutes, notify the identity team at the address below.

pager mailbox: druwyn@norvaio.corp

## Releases

ShelfStream publishes catalogue-import builds monthly. Plugin authors must target the import schema pinned in each release tag; MARC-variant mappings change between minors, so re-run the Stackwise conformance suite before publishing. Unsigned plugin bundles are rejected by the registry. All official ShelfStream artifacts are signed; verify downloads before building against them using the key below.

release key, yafof-kadup: bky4_soBk

Each release artifact is built on the Quenby CI runner and signed before deployment to the reminder workers. Unsigned artifacts are rejected at deploy time by the Varnholt gatekeeper service, which verifies signatures against the key registered for this pipeline. Rotation occurs quarterly; the previous key remains valid for a seven-day overlap window. Reviewers should confirm the gatekeeper policy matches the key below. The current signing key for ReminderCron is:

rollout seal: bky9_aBG1gvAyU

Troubleshooting: GiftNote Receipt Mailer

If donors report missing receipts, first check the Mailhollow queue dashboard for stalled batches. Retry any batch older than two hours. If retries fail with a 401, the mailer's credentials have expired and must be rotated. To confirm the outage, call the send endpoint manually using the current token, shown below.

session JWT of yawep-yawep = eyJhbGciOiJIUzI1NiIsInR5cCI6IkpXVCJ9.eyJzdWIiOiI3pWF3_In0.aXYsHiog

Plugin authors: SquatterWatch scans your manifest on every publish to the Fendry registry. Step 4: register your plugin with the scanner gateway. Builds fail closed if the scanner can't authenticate, so set this up before your first push. In your plugin's root, create a .env file and add the line below:

vault entry, yahaf-tagug: LEDGER_TOKEN20=884d77d1a8b98aa4edfb